feat(encryption): report count of users still holding encrypted data (#687)
## What

`encryption:notify-removal` now prints, on every run, the total number
of **non-deleted** users who still hold legacy browser-encrypted data:

```
4 non-deleted user(s) still have encrypted data.
```

The count is taken before the billing exclusion, so it reflects the full
remaining scope of browser-encrypted data. Soft-deleted users are
excluded (model default scope), as are users whose data is already
plaintext.

## Why

It's the signal for deciding when the browser-side encryption code can
finally be removed: once this reaches zero, nothing in the app depends
on client-side encrypted columns anymore.

## Not changed

Email-sending logic is untouched. Subscribed users are still never
warned — the recipient set continues to go through
`excludeBilledUsers()` exactly as before. This PR only adds a reporting
line.

## Testing

- New test asserts the count spans everyone with encrypted data
(subscribed included), while excluding soft-deleted and plaintext users,
and that sending still skips the subscribed user.
- Full `NotifyEncryptedDataRemovalCommandTest` suite green.

fix(encryption): never email or delete users who are still being billed (#656)
## What

The `encryption:delete-accounts` and `encryption:notify-removal`
commands target users who still hold legacy client-side encrypted data.
They should **never** warn or delete an account that is still being
billed.

## Changes

- Add `excludeBilledUsers()` to the shared
`FindsUsersWithLegacyEncryption` trait. It drops any user where
`hasActiveSubscriptionOrTrial()` is true — a valid subscription outside
its grace period, or an active generic trial. This reuses the existing
domain method (whose docblock already states such users must cancel
before deletion) instead of reimplementing Cashier's subscription-status
logic in SQL.
- Both commands apply the filter right after fetching their candidates.
- Eager-load `subscriptions` in the base query to avoid an N+1 when the
filter runs.

## Tests

- `it never deletes a subscribed user` (delete command)
- `it never warns a subscribed user` (notify command)

Both new tests plus the existing suite pass (8/8). Pint clean.

feat(encryption): commands to warn and remove inactive encrypted-data accounts (#633)
## What

Two artisan commands to retire the remaining legacy client-side
encrypted data in production (transactions with
`description_iv`/`notes_iv`, accounts with `name_iv`).

- **`encryption:notify-removal`** — queues a re-engagement/deletion
warning to every user who still has an encrypted transaction or account.
Reuses `SendUpdateEmailJob` (queue `emails`, dedup via `UserMailLog`,
50/day pacing). The email is framed as an **inactivity** cleanup (no
mention of encryption) and pitches recent additions (AI insights, bank
integrations, etc.).
- **`encryption:delete-accounts`** — soft-deletes and anonymizes
(`User::markAsDeleted()`) those users **only** if they have not signed
in within the grace window (`--days`, default 7, via `last_active_at`).
Anyone who came back is spared, and the demo account is always excluded.

Both support `--dry-run` and `--force`, and share the target query via
the `FindsUsersWithLegacyEncryption` concern so the warning and the
deletion always target the same set.

## Intended manual run

`notify-removal --dry-run` → run for real → wait 7 days →
`delete-accounts --dry-run` → run for real.

## Notes / scope

- Deletion is a **soft-delete + email anonymization** (accounts become
unusable); it does not hard-purge rows, and does not cancel Stripe
subscriptions or revoke bank connections (unlike `user:delete`). Legacy
inactive accounts are unlikely to have either; handle separately if
needed.
- Email copy is plain English (matches the existing `mail/updates/*`
convention), no new `__()` keys.

## Tests

`tests/Feature/Console/NotifyEncryptedDataRemovalCommandTest.php` and
`DeleteEncryptedDataAccountsCommandTest.php` — 6 passing (targeting,
queue, dry-run, grace window, demo exclusion).

feat(features): support percentage rollouts in feature:enable (#592)
## What

`feature:enable <feature> <target>` now accepts a percentage like `25%`
as the target, in addition to a user email or `all`.

```bash
php artisan feature:enable AiConsentSettings 25%
```

This activates the feature for a random `ceil(total * N/100)` sample of
the **current** users, persisted in Pennant's `features` table — no need
to edit the feature class and redeploy for a percentage-based rollout.

## Notes

- It targets the current user base. New users keep the feature's default
(`false`) unless the command is run again.
- Percentage is validated to be between 1 and 100.
- `feature:disable` was left unchanged — disabling for a random subset
has no clear use case.

## Test plan

- [x] `feature:enable AiConsentSettings 40%` enables the feature for
exactly 4 of 10 users
- [x] An out-of-range percentage (`0%`) fails

feat(drip): email users stuck on the paywall a day after onboarding (#562)
## What

Sends an automated follow-up email the day after a user finishes
onboarding but stays stuck on the paywall, asking why they didn't
continue and inviting a direct reply.

## Why

Users who connect a bank account during onboarding but never pick a plan
are permanently redirected to the paywall by `EnsureUserIsSubscribed` —
they finish onboarding and then can't access the app. This reaches out
to understand the friction and recover them.

## Who gets the email (the genuinely stuck cohort)

- `onboarded_at` is calendar-yesterday (`whereDate('onboarded_at',
today()->subDay())`)
- Has an active banking connection (`bankingConnections()->exists()`)
- No Pro plan (`hasProPlan()` is false)
- Hasn't already received this email (idempotent via `UserMailLog`)

Users **without** a bank connection are excluded: they fall through to
free access after seeing the paywall once, so they aren't stuck.

## How

- New `email:paywall-follow-up` command scans the cohort daily and
queues the job — scheduled `dailyAt('10:00')` Europe/Madrid in
`routes/console.php`.
- New `DripEmailType::PaywallFollowUp` (`paywall_follow_up`) +
idempotent send job following the existing drip pattern.
- Short, human Markdown email with an explicit `replyTo`
(`hi@whisper.money`) so replies reach a real inbox.
- Spanish copy added to `lang/es.json`.

## Tests

10 new tests (correct cohort matched; wrong day / no bank / Pro plan
excluded; no double-send; no-op when drip disabled). `pint` clean.

## Note

There was no existing user-scanning drip command (current drips dispatch
with `delay()` on `Registered`). Since "stuck on paywall" state isn't
known at registration time, a daily scanning command is the right fit.

Add banks:set-logo artisan command (#213)
## Summary

- Adds `banks:set-logo {bank} {url}` artisan command to download,
process, and assign a logo to a bank by UUID
- Installs `intervention/image:^3.0` (GD driver) for image processing
- Image is validated to be square (returns an error if not), resized
down to max 250×250px if needed, stored as PNG on the `public` disk at
`banks/logos/{uuid}.png`, and the bank's `logo` field is updated with
the public URL

## Usage

```
php artisan banks:set-logo <bank-uuid> <image-url>
```

## Tests

7 feature tests covering success, no-resize, bank not found, HTTP
failure, non-image content type, non-square image, and invalid image
content.
